There had seemingly been no limit to the grand political ambitions of Maximilian II Emanuel, but he ultimately failed to turn any of them into reality. One of his greatest schemes would on the other hand be realized by his son, Charles Albert. In 1742 he became the Holy Roman Emperor Charles VII, and thereby dethroned the Habsburgs from that position for the first time in centuries.
